The advent of blockchain technology has ushered in a new era of financial interaction, a paradigm shift that has fundamentally altered how we perceive and manage the movement of value. At its core, blockchain money flow represents the transparent, immutable, and decentralized record of financial transactions occurring on a distributed ledger. It's akin to a digital river, constantly flowing, carrying value across borders and between individuals without the need for traditional intermediaries. This concept, while seemingly simple, holds profound implications for everything from personal finance to global commerce.

Imagine a world where every financial transaction is publicly visible, yet anonymized, offering an unprecedented level of accountability and trust. This is the promise of blockchain money flow. Unlike traditional banking systems, where transactions are often opaque and controlled by a central authority, blockchain operates on a peer-to-peer network. Each transaction is verified by a consensus mechanism, added to a block, and then cryptographically linked to the previous block, forming an unbroken chain. This inherent immutability means that once a transaction is recorded, it cannot be altered or deleted, creating a permanent and auditable history of all financial activity.

The beauty of blockchain money flow lies in its democratization of finance. It empowers individuals and businesses to engage in direct, secure, and often faster transactions, bypassing the often cumbersome and costly processes associated with traditional financial institutions. This disintermediation is a cornerstone of blockchain's appeal. Think about international remittances: traditionally, sending money across borders could involve multiple banks, currency conversions, and significant fees, often taking days to complete. With blockchain, cryptocurrencies like Bitcoin or stablecoins can be sent almost instantaneously, with fees that are a fraction of the traditional cost, directly from sender to receiver. This efficiency is a game-changer, particularly for individuals in developing countries or those who rely on regular cross-border payments.

The transparency inherent in blockchain money flow is another transformative element. While individual identities are typically represented by pseudonymous wallet addresses, the flow of funds between these addresses is visible to anyone on the network. This open ledger provides an unparalleled level of auditability. Regulators, auditors, and even curious individuals can trace the movement of funds, making it significantly harder to engage in illicit activities like money laundering or fraud. This transparency fosters a greater sense of trust and accountability within the financial ecosystem. It’s like having a universally accessible accounting book, where every entry is verifiable.

The security aspect of blockchain money flow is paramount. The cryptographic principles underpinning blockchain technology make it incredibly resistant to tampering and fraud. Each block is secured with complex mathematical algorithms, and the decentralized nature of the network means that there is no single point of failure. To alter a transaction, an attacker would need to control a majority of the network's computing power, an undertaking that is practically impossible for most public blockchains. This robust security framework is what gives users confidence in entrusting their digital assets to the blockchain.

Beyond cryptocurrencies, the concept of blockchain money flow extends to stablecoins. These are digital assets designed to minimize price volatility by pegging their value to a stable asset, such as a fiat currency like the US dollar or a commodity like gold. Stablecoins are crucial for bridging the gap between traditional finance and the blockchain world, offering the stability of fiat with the speed and efficiency of blockchain transactions. Their money flow is similarly transparent and traceable on their underlying blockchains.

Another significant development is the rise of Decentralized Finance (DeFi). DeFi platforms leverage blockchain technology to recreate traditional financial services – lending, borrowing, trading, insurance – in a decentralized manner. The money flow within DeFi is a complex web of smart contract interactions. Smart contracts are self-executing contracts with the terms of the agreement directly written into code. When certain conditions are met, the smart contract automatically executes the agreed-upon actions, such as releasing funds or transferring ownership. This automation further streamlines and secures the money flow, removing the need for human intervention and reducing the risk of error or manipulation.

One of the most exciting frontiers is the rise of Non-Fungible Tokens (NFTs). While often associated with digital art, NFTs are fundamentally about unique digital ownership, and their money flow represents the transfer of these unique assets. Each NFT is recorded on a blockchain, creating an immutable proof of ownership. When an NFT is bought or sold, this transaction is recorded on the blockchain, detailing the transfer of value and ownership from one digital wallet to another. This has opened up new avenues for artists, creators, and collectors to engage with digital assets, establishing a new form of money flow tied to digital scarcity and provenance. The royalties embedded in many NFT smart contracts also ensure a continuous flow of value back to creators with every resale, a novel concept in traditional markets.

Decentralized Autonomous Organizations (DAOs) represent a fascinating evolution in how organizations can be structured and governed, with their money flow being a key operational element. DAOs are essentially organizations run by code and governed by their token holders. Decisions are made through voting, and the treasury of a DAO, often holding significant amounts of cryptocurrency, is managed through smart contracts. The money flow within a DAO is dictated by proposals and community consensus, offering a transparent and democratic approach to organizational finance. When a proposal to fund a project is approved, the smart contract automatically disburses funds from the DAO’s treasury, creating a clear and auditable money flow.

However, the journey of blockchain money flow is not without its challenges. Scalability remains a significant hurdle for many blockchains, as networks can struggle to handle a high volume of transactions at speed. Energy consumption, particularly for proof-of-work blockchains like Bitcoin, is another area of concern. Nonetheless, ongoing innovation in areas like layer-2 scaling solutions, sharding, and more energy-efficient consensus mechanisms (like proof-of-stake) are actively addressing these issues, paving the way for a more robust and sustainable future for blockchain money flow.

The regulatory landscape is also still evolving. As blockchain technology and its associated money flows become more mainstream, governments and regulatory bodies worldwide are working to establish frameworks that ensure consumer protection, prevent illicit activities, and maintain financial stability. Striking the right balance between fostering innovation and implementing necessary safeguards is a critical ongoing discussion. The clarity and traceability of money flow on the blockchain are often cited as beneficial for regulatory oversight, provided the right tools and approaches are developed.

Privacy is another important consideration. While transparency is a hallmark of blockchain, the pseudonymous nature of wallet addresses can sometimes be insufficient for individuals or businesses requiring a higher degree of privacy. Solutions like zero-knowledge proofs and privacy-focused cryptocurrencies are emerging to address this, allowing for secure and confidential transactions while still maintaining the integrity of the blockchain. The money flow, in these instances, can be verified without revealing sensitive details.

One of the most significant ways blockchain is enabling smarter earning is through Decentralized Finance, or DeFi. DeFi aims to recreate traditional financial services – lending, borrowing, trading, insurance, and more – without relying on intermediaries like banks or brokers. Instead, these services are built on smart contracts, self-executing agreements with the terms of the contract directly written into code. These smart contracts run on blockchains, most notably Ethereum, facilitating peer-to-peer transactions with unparalleled efficiency and lower fees.

Within DeFi, opportunities abound for earning passive income. Yield farming, for instance, involves users depositing their cryptocurrency assets into liquidity pools to facilitate trades on decentralized exchanges (DEXs). In return for providing this liquidity, users earn rewards in the form of transaction fees and newly minted tokens. While it can be complex and carries risks, savvy participants can generate impressive returns by strategically allocating their assets across different protocols and optimizing their farming strategies. It’s a form of actively managing your digital assets to work for you, rather than simply holding them.

Lending and borrowing protocols are another cornerstone of DeFi earning. Platforms allow users to lend out their crypto assets to borrowers, earning interest in the process. Conversely, users can borrow crypto by providing collateral, often at competitive rates compared to traditional loans. The beauty of this system lies in its automation and transparency. Smart contracts manage collateralization and interest rates, ensuring that both lenders and borrowers are operating within a secure and predictable framework. This creates a dynamic market where capital can be deployed more efficiently, generating returns for those who provide it.

Staking is another accessible avenue for earning smarter. Many blockchain networks utilize a consensus mechanism called Proof-of-Stake (PoS), where validators are chosen to create new blocks based on the number of coins they hold and are willing to "stake" as collateral. By staking your own cryptocurrency, you contribute to the network's security and operation and, in return, receive rewards, often in the form of more of that cryptocurrency. It’s akin to earning interest on your savings, but with the added element of contributing to the infrastructure of a decentralized network. The yields can vary significantly depending on the cryptocurrency and the network's activity, but it offers a relatively straightforward way to generate passive income.
